Acer has officially entered the rapidly expanding spatial computing market with the unveiling of VisionWear smart glasses, a new wearable platform designed to challenge major players including Meta, Apple, and Qualcomm-backed ecosystems.

As the future of computing moves beyond traditional screens, Acer is betting that smart glasses could become the next major personal technology platform.

Inside Acer VisionWear

The flagship VisionWear S1 smart glasses are designed to look and feel like ordinary eyewear while delivering augmented reality capabilities through lightweight hardware and cloud-connected computing.

  • Dual MicroLED waveguide display technology
  • Ultra-lightweight 48-gram design
  • Wi-Fi 7 and Bluetooth 5.4 connectivity
  • Distributed processing through smartphones and PCs
  • Real-time notifications and translation features

VisionWear vs Meta Ray-Ban Smart Glasses

Feature Acer VisionWear S1 Meta Ray-Ban
Display Technology Dual MicroLED Waveguide HUD No Display
Weight 48g 49g
Architecture Tethered Cloud Computing Onboard Processing
Main Focus Productivity & Workflows Content & Social Media
Unlike many competitors focused on entertainment and content creation, Acer is positioning VisionWear as a serious productivity tool.

Enterprise and Professional Applications

  • Virtual multi-monitor workspaces
  • Remote technical support assistance
  • Medical and healthcare environments
  • Industrial logistics operations
  • Hands-free access to critical information

Acer's strategy leverages its long-standing enterprise relationships by targeting organizations that require real-time access to information while keeping workers' hands free.

Challenges Ahead

  • Consumer privacy concerns
  • Battery and performance limitations
  • Social acceptance of wearable technology
  • Competition from larger ecosystems
  • Need for compelling daily-use applications
The biggest challenge may not be the technology itself, but convincing consumers that smart glasses provide enough value to become part of everyday life.
